This implies that the law enforcement management has a lot of belief in the members of the staff and trusts their judgment in the course of duty (Gonzalez, 2007). This will give the staff motivation in that they know the management believes in them hence they will perform to the best of their abilities so that they can live up to the expectations and confidence the management has on them. In the case where the management does not believe in the abilities of the staff then the members of the staff will always be on the look out since they know that management does not believe in them. Therefore they will not work effectively since they will have the feeling that they are always being watched. This quality is thus very important in optimizing the performance of the staff.
If the economic/machine and affective/affiliation models are combined then the result would resemble the growth-open system theory of motivation (Cordner, 2013). The term 'open' in this model is meant to imply employees are influenced by their environment, including the environmental factors existing outside the workplace. Police Motivation A relationship does exist between control and motivation in a police force. Generally police officers are used to working under a fairly individual and self structured environment. Thus when new order is established it is often the source of conflict. Police Management Management, irrespective of the particular industry, has a profound effect on organizational effectiveness. For one, management has the ability to drive results through proper motivation and incentives. A manager must also effective lead through his or her ability to inspire action on the part of subordinates. These broad requirements of management demands various skill sets.
